Hi! I have a card with a checklist where the items have multiple due dates dependent on one target date. Is there a way to enter a target date and have all of the other due dates "cascade"? Eg: If my next target due date for a recurring event is June 1, and I have tasks that regularly need to be completed 3 days before, 1 week before, 5 days after, etc. is there a way to make them auto-populate, so to speak?
Hi @Sarah Khan, I'm afraid that this isn't a feature in Trello right now, and I'm happy to pass the idea onto our team for consideration!
